Partnership facts

  • Manobala and Senthil first shared screen space in Sirai Paravai (1987) because director R. Selvaraj needed a comedian who could also play a serious sidekick. Senthil was already a hit, but Manobala was still finding his footing. The director paired them specifically to balance Senthil's loud energy with Manobala's deadpan reactions.
  • In Thendral Sudum (1989), Manobala and Senthil developed a silent rhythm: Senthil would deliver the punchline, and Manobala would hold his reaction for an extra beat — making the joke land harder. That timing became their trademark in Mallu Vetti Minor (1990).
  • Manobala and Senthil stayed close friends off-screen for decades. When Manobala turned director, he cast Senthil in his 1997 film Nesam — even though the film tanked. Senthil later said in an interview that he did the film for free because Manobala was 'like a brother who never asked for favours.'
  • Their 2023 reunion in Kick happened because director Prashanth wanted a nostalgic comedy duo for a flashback scene. Manobala and Senthil's 10-second cameo got the loudest cheer in theatres — and directly inspired the makers to plan a full-length comedy track for their next film.
  • Senthil once said about Manobala: 'He never tried to steal a scene. He just stood there and made me look funnier. That's a rare thing in comedy.'
